Vue.js 让前发更简单高效_会帮你处理_Vue.js 让前端开发更简单高效

Vue.js 让前端开发更简单高效!


一、简化了开发流程

Vue.js 通过几个关键点让开发流程变得更简单:

单文件组件

Vue.js 允许你将 HTML、CSS 和 JavaScript 放在一个 .vue 文件里,这样代码就更加直观,调试和维护也更方便。

声明式渲染

Vue.js 使用声明式编程,让数据和 DOM 的绑定变得简单。你只需要关注数据变化,Vue 会帮你处理 DOM 更新。

双向数据绑定

Vue.js 支持双向数据绑定,数据变化自动更新视图,视图变化也自动更新数据,减少了手动同步的工作。

二、提高了代码的可维护性

Vue.js 提供了多种机制来提高代码的可维护性:

组件化开发

Vue.js 鼓励组件化开发,将应用拆分成多个可复用的组件,使代码更模块化、清晰,便于维护和测试。

清晰的生命周期钩子

Vue.js 提供了生命周期钩子,让你可以在组件的不同阶段执行操作,更好地管理组件的状态和行为。

强大的工具支持

Vue.js 生态系统提供了丰富的工具,如 Vue CLI、Vue Router 和 Vuex,简化了开发、路由管理和状态管理。

三、增强了用户体验

Vue.js 通过以下方式提升用户体验:

响应式数据绑定

Vue.js 的响应式数据绑定让界面自动更新,提供流畅直观的用户体验。

高性能

Vue.js 的虚拟 DOM 和高效算法保证了应用的高性能,即使在复杂应用中也能保持流畅。

丰富的动画效果

Vue.js 提供丰富的动画和过渡效果,让用户界面更加生动。

四、提升了开发效率

Vue.js 提供多种工具和特性来提升开发效率:

Vue CLI

Vue CLI 是一个强大的脚手架工具,帮助快速创建和配置 Vue 项目。

热重载

Vue.js 支持热重载,修改代码后无需刷新页面即可看到效果。

丰富的生态系统

Vue.js 生态系统提供了丰富的插件和库,如 Vue Router、Vuex 和 Vuetify,提升开发效率。

Vue.js 通过简化开发流程、提高代码可维护性、增强用户体验和提升开发效率,极大地便利了前端开发者。深入学习 Vue.js 的核心概念和最佳实践,充分利用其生态系统中的工具和资源,可以帮助你优化开发流程和提升用户体验。

相关问答FAQs

1. Vue方便了前端开发的快速迭代和组件化开发

Vue.js 通过模块化和组件化,使得代码重用和维护变得容易,提高了开发效率。

2. Vue方便了前端开发的数据驱动和响应式编程

Vue.js 的数据驱动和响应式特性,让开发者只需关注数据变化,无需手动操作 DOM,简化了开发复杂性。

3. Vue方便了前端开发的跨平台和移动开发

Vue.js 结合 Weex 技术,使得开发者可以快速构建跨平台的移动应用程序。